Irvine Housing Association wanted to reduce its paper storage requirements, cut down on the time taken locating documents and improve data security. It needed a solution powerful enough to manage documentation across the whole organisation with the flexibility to link to existing systems.
The solution
The implementation of Documotive’s Integrated Document Management System for Irvine Housing Associations’ HR documents and Housing Tenancy files.
Outcome
As an expanding social housing provider based in Ayrshire, Irvine Housing Association recognised that it would be beneficial to address issues including paper storage, customer service efficiency and data security, in order to maintain the high standard of service which its customers had come to expect.
Following an extensive review of service providers, Irvine Housing Association selected Documotive to provide a document management system which was capable of full integration with its existing systems and had the capability of being rolled out to additional departments in the future. Documotive’s specialised knowledge of the social housing sector, and the data protection issues which it faces, was one of the major deciding factors when Irvine was choosing its supplier.
IT manager, Angus MacLeod, explains: “Data protection and security are enormously important to Irvine Housing Association as many of the HR and housing tenancy documents are potentially sensitive. It is paramount that we maintain both employee and customer confidentiality. The Documotive system provides a paper-free audit trail which can be traced back to see exactly which authorised personnel have accessed documents and for what
purpose. This feature is invaluable, especially given the recent high-profile cases of lost data.” Storing all of the Housing Tenancy files electronically
also meets the Association’s commitment to sustainability and environmentally-sound working practices.
